James Monroe Children's Museum was conceived as a result of a cancelled field trip to Columbia State Park. Teachers Ed Gwartney, Susan Miller, and Sandra Carter had arranged a Social Studies trip to Columbia, a "gold rush" town above Sonora, Ca. to a culminating experience for their students Social Studies Unit. When their bus plan fell apart, the teachers decided to construct their own "Digging's" town and "People" it with their own students! Their classes,as well as 600 other students from the "bus cancellation".

   James Monroe Children's Museum and Discovery Center, is a "gold rush" era museum run by 4th,5th and 6th graders. The information used has been "gleaned" by the students from the many diaries of that era.

   Currently there are 22 "stations" teaching visitors from throughout the history of California from the 1840's to the 1850's. Taught by students to students.... 1300 last year alone!
